But on the flip side let me just say that times, and tastes, have been changing. It’s like a new generation, a whole new revolution, just growing stronger and stronger. Black-owned vegan and vegetarian restaurants have been opening at a quick clip in New York and elsewhere, catering to a population that wants to reverse grim health statistics and adopt a more healthful lifestyle. Vegetarian entrepreneurs also claim that growing numbers of blacks in the hip-hop generation have acquired a taste for tofu ((GROSS…lol)) and soy patties. The explosion is hitting black communities in New York, Los Angeles, Chicago, Atlanta, and St. Louis. It’s definitely a phenomenon considering black people’s long love affair with greasy foods. The quality difference in the food that Boosy mentions also applies to all fast food restaurants and worse- grocery stores. Head to a grocery store in suburbia and you get fresh food, lots of variety, and usually better prices. Head to a store in the ghetto and you get what’s canned, frozen, freeze dried and WAY overpriced.
